  14. This is just a heads up so you can plan accordingly if you should decide to go ahead with this project. If you need pistons that aren't off the shelf parts, you better plan ahead for the looooong lead time. I don't know if things have gotten better in the last year, but last year lead time was between 6 and 9 months.

    Hello,

    One hot summer, we had heard about the Championship Drag Boat Races to be held in the Marine Stadium in Belmont Shore area of Long Beach. We knew where this was due to it being in the hot rod cruising area during our teenage high school years. Although it was in another high school’s proximity, we still drove around when we frequented Belmont Shore.

    Then in college, the campus was within a mile or so of the stadium. Back then, the campus had views toward the ocean and the Alamitos Bay that the Marine Stadium connects for ocean access. So, with that in mind, the water’s edge was cooling and the place was packed with fumes in the air. It was like being in the Lion’s Dragstrip pits area with the multiple drag boats motors being fired up for tuning and getting prepped for a run down the normally smooth waters of the Marine Stadium.

    Jnaki

    Some of the top drag boat racers in the So Cal region and some from out of state were in the competition runs. It was hot and crowded. But, the action in the pits area and in the water were outstanding and well worth the “hot” environment by the water’s edge.
